Alcohol suspected in Hwy. 35 rollover that injures two
LA CROSSE, Wis. -- Two people are injured, one seriously, in a suspected alcohol-related rollover acccident on Highway 35.
The accident happened just after 3:30 a.m. Sunday on Highway 35 near Nutbush City Limits.
La Crosse Police say 21-year-old Josiah Kemp of Onalaska was driving south when he lost control and rolled his vehicle down an embankment by Nutbush.
22-year-old Jakob Waite, a passenger in the vehicle, was trapped inside. Once rescue crews freed him, Waite was taken to Gundersen Lutheran in La Crosse with what police describe as a very serious head injury. At last check, Waite was in critical condition.
Kemp was taken to Mayo Clinic Health System in La Crosse with non-life threatening injuries.
La Crosse Police are investigating the accident, but say alcohol may have played a role in the accident.
